Markdown: recognize wiki style image links

When the --wiki option is active, recognize wiki-style image
links in the format:

    [[link-to-image.png|align=left,alt=text]]

Where any "well-known" image suffix may be used in place of ".png"
and the "|..." part is optional but may specify any of the "width=",
"height=", "align=" or "alt=" keywords (provided alt= is always last).

If full wiki style links have been enabled (via the `--wiki` option),
image links may be created using the wiki syntax like so:
[[some-image.png]]
[[other-image.jpg|alt=text for alt]]
[[image-left.svg|align=left]]
[[image-on-right.jpeg|align=right]]
[[in-a-div.gif|align=center]]
[[image-right.svg|align=left,alt=text for image]]
[[scaled.svg|width=200,height=100,alt=scaled image]]
For a wiki style image link to be recognized, the "link" part (which
is just the part to the left of the `|` if it's present), must:
* not have any embedded spaces (leading/trailing will be stripped)
* must end in a well-known image suffix (case insensitively)
Currently only `.png`, `.gif`, `.jpg`, `.jpeg`, `.svg` and `.svgz`
are recognized as "well-known image suffixes".
If the optional "|..." part is present for a wiki image link, then
the "alt=" part must be at the end as it will consume all the
remaining text. Currently only the "align=", "width=", "height="
and "alt=" keywords are recognized. Keywords are comma (",")
separated (with optional surrounding whitespace). Note that width
and height are in pixels.
Using either "left" or "right" for the "align=" keyword causes the
image to be floated either left or right respectively. Using
"center" for the "align=" keyword causes the image to be placed in
its own "div" with a "center" alignment.
